"Vinnutæki" (plural "vinnutæki") is an Icelandic term that translates literally to "work tool" or "work device". In modern usage it refers to any instrument, equipment or technology that facilitates the performance of professional tasks, whether in factory, office, field or creative environments. The concept includes both manual implements, such as hammers and screwdrivers, and more complex machinery, like CNC machines or computer software systems, that increase productivity and precision.
